// COLD START GUARD — read before touching this.
// Handlers in the Lanternfall fleet take ~2.8s cold versus 40ms warm.
// This constant sets the pre-warm pool size; lowering it below 6
// caused the pager storm of last March. If latency alerts fire,
// check the warm-pool metrics before scaling — cold starts spike
// after every deploy for ~10 minutes and that is expected.
// Confirm you are on the deployed revision by comparing against
// the token recorded below.

build token for kagaf-hahof: htk14_9d3d4d26d7d8de

## Tuning Lint Rules for SQL Files

Plugin authors extending `sqlgroom` should understand how the core ruleset is weighted before adding their own checks. Each rule carries a severity score and a line-budget, and plugins that exceed the aggregate budget are skipped at load time. To keep your plugin compatible, align with the baseline constants shown here.

tuning constants:
QUOTAS = {
    "druwyn": 5,
    "holix": 5,
    "zorath": 5,
    "holwyn": 10,
}

# GC pauses in Matchwell

The Matchwell matching service runs on a generational collector and occasionally hits stop-the-world pauses over 800ms during peak pairing load. These pauses can delay audit-log flushes, which matters for your review: events are buffered, not dropped. Heap sizing and pause budgets are tuned per region by the Tellgrove platform team. Current tuning parameters and pause histograms are published on the internal page.

wiki page, tahaf-tajog: https://jira.ordindyn.corp/pipeline

## Artifact Signing — Currency Rounding Patch

The fix for rounding errors in the Meridex conversion module ships as a signed hotfix artifact. Reviewers should confirm the patch applies banker's rounding at the final aggregation step only, never per line item, and that regression fixtures cover three-decimal currencies. Once review passes, the build is signed before distribution. Verify the artifact against the signing key that follows.

release key, fajef-kajeg: bky19_LdLu6Ne6FLi8he2c24d